Worthington Bank Welcomes New Arlington Market President and Chief Lending Officer

Worthington Bank is pleased to announce the hiring of Brian Compton as Arlington Market President and Mark Evans as Chief Lending Officer. Evans will assume his role following the reXrement of the bank’s current CLO, Dan Mocio.
“Both Compton and Evans bring a total of six decades of industry experience with them to Worthington Bank,
which will be a great benefit to the company and to our customers,” said Gary Price, Worthington Bank CEO.
“Their experXse and leadership skills will help drive growth, and we’re excited to see the impact they will have
on Worthington Bank in the years to come.”
Before joining Worthington Bank, Brian Compton spent two decades in the industry, moving from Branch
Manager to Commercial Lender, and then into Regional and Market Leadership roles. Prior to banking, he
served as a Captain in the U.S. Army, Infantry. He has a Business Management degree from the University of
Tampa and adended the ABA/Stonier Graduate School of Banking. Compton is a father of three and enjoys
Xme spent in the great outdoors.
Mark Evans has spent more than 40 years in lending and execuXve management roles with banks in both
Louisiana and Texas. His leadership, underwriXng and relaXonship building skills have made him an asset and
propelled his growth in the industry. Evans earned his B.B.A. in Finance at Baylor University and is also a
graduate of the Southwest Graduate School of Banking at SMU. A Baylor Bear to the core, he never misses an
opportunity to cheer for his team.
